Step 2: Plan Your Narrative

Understanding Telar’s narrative model will help you plan your content effectively.

Each page in your Telar site contains one or more stories, which can be independent or related narratives. Stories unfold through successive steps that show an image (or a detail of an image) alongside a brief text.

Planning Your Story

Before you start gathering materials or building your site, take time to sketch out your story’s structure:

  1. What stories do you want to tell?
  2. What are the key moments in each story?
  3. What images or details will anchor each step in the story?
  4. What information belongs in the brief answer and what in the panel layers?

Drafting these answers and panels will make the implementation much easier.
